Title: 1H, 13C, and 15N Chemical Shift Assignments and coupling constants for the HRDC domain from S. cerevisiae Sgs1 RecQ helicase
Deposition date: 1999-10-22 Original release date: 2000-07-18
Authors: Liu, Zhihong; Macias, Maria; Bottomley, Matthew; Stier, Gunter; Linge, Jens; Nilges, Michael; Bork, Peer; Sattler, Michael
Citation: Liu, Zhihong; Macias, Maria; Bottomley, Matthew; Stier, Gunter; Linge, Jens; Nilges, Michael; Bork, Peer; Sattler, Michael. "The 3D structure of the HRDC domain and implications for the Werner and Bloom syndrome proteins." Structure 7, 1557-1566 (1999).
Assembly members:
HRDC domain of Sgs1 RecQ helicase, polymer, 91 residues, 10681 Da.
Natural source: Common Name: Baker Taxonomy ID: 4932 Superkingdom: not available Kingdom: not available Genus/species: Eukaryota Fungi
Experimental source: Production method: recombinant technology Host organism: Escherichia coli
